CHINA. China - Great Britain. Voyage of the Junk "Keying" White Metal Medal, 1848. PCGS MS-61.
BHM-2315. By T. Halliday. Diameter: 45mm. Obverse: View of the junk Keying under sail right; Reverse: Legend in 16 lines providing information about the junk and its journey. Struck to commemorate the first Chinese junk--the Keying--to sail from Hong Kong to Great Britain. The voyage lasted 477 days.
